  9. Macy's 4th of July Fireworks -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Macy's_4th_of_July_Fireworks

    The first Macy's fireworks show in New York City was held on July 1, 1958 to celebrate the department store's 100th anniversary. [2] In 1976, Macy's partnered with The Walt Disney Company to hold a fireworks display in honor of the United States' bicentennial, leading to the show becoming an annual tradition.
